This news just made my day. FCT minister should also do something about herdsmen movement with cows in Abuja, it sometimes causes accident and traffic obstruction on major road, their smelling dung litter some streets. Herders should be organized just like Poultry/Pig rearing operators. Population is increasing, land is becoming scarce, herders need to adopt new method they are private business operators, let them buy land and be in one place instead of looking for free land from FG. Government can also assist them with vetinary and subsidies anytime they assist other farmers 4 Likes 2 Shares |
